Every line drawn by architect Oscar Niemeyer had the power to charm the eye and make history. But his curves were not just limited to his remarkable architectonic work. 

The architect responsible for some of the most inventive and revolutionary Modern buildings also created sculpturesque pieces of furniture, re-flecting the beautifully drawn curves in his architecture. Through their close partnership with the Oscar Niemeyer Foundation, ETEL is the exclusive manufacturer of these pieces.
“I am not attracted to the right angle, nor to the straight, hard, inflexible line created by men. I am at-tracted to the free and sensual curve, the one I find on my country’s mountains, its winding rivers, the waves in the sea, and on the body of the favorite woman. The entire universe is made of curves, the bend-ing universe of Einstein” – Oscar Niemeyer.

OSCAR NIEMEYER

Oscar Niemeyer, representative of Rio de Janeiro architecture school, is considered to be the architect who had the most plastic influence on Brazilian architecture. He is credited with introducing the curve into universal modern architecture. “Modern world architecture was cubic, straight and very prismatic".
